A Risk Assessment and Management Policy establishes how your business systematically spots operational hazards, evaluates technical vulnerabilities, and handles compliance gaps before they disrupt daily operations. Without a documented framework, critical blind spots frequently go unnoticed until an unexpected vendor failure, audit finding, or security incident triggers a costly emergency response. Establishing formal guidelines ensures your entire team treats potential threats consistently, prioritizes corrective actions effectively, and avoids relying on unwritten assumptions when problems arise.

A structured risk management policy protects your business from avoidable operational and financial shocks. It lays out objective evaluation criteria so team leads score hazards accurately instead of relying on subjective opinions. The policy clearly assigns accountability for maintaining your risk register, defines strict timelines for mitigating identified weaknesses, and standardizes how you vet third-party vendors. It also removes ambiguity by detailing exactly which executives hold the authority to formally accept residual risks.

Smaller companies often face the same operational, vendor, and technical vulnerabilities as large enterprises but with fewer resources to absorb unexpected losses. Having a written policy ensures your team catches vulnerabilities early, prioritizes limited remediation resources effectively, and satisfies the vendor security questionnaires required by prospective enterprise clients.

Most organizations conduct an annual policy review while updating their active risk register quarterly or after major operational changes, such as adopting new software or entering new markets.
